Sky to broadcast 2012 GP2 races

Sky Sports have announced that their forthcoming Sky Sports F1 HD channel will broadcast live coverage of the 2012 GP2 Series.

The new channel will screen all races from this year's extended 12-round GP2 calendar which begins in Malaysia on 23-25 March. Both the weekend's two races, Feature and Sprint, will be shown in full giving motorsport fans a chance to watch the F1 drivers of the future in action.

In addition to live coverage, Sky have also confirmed that their weekly magazine show, presented by Georgie Thompson and Ted Kravitz, will provide coverage, analysis and discussion of the races from the likes of Monaco, Monza and Silverstone, Spa and Singapore.

Sky Sports F1 HD will also broadcast every round of the 2012 Formula One season, which GP2 runs alongside as an F1 feeder series, as well as GP3.

Sky's Executive Producer Martin Turner said: "We are delighted to be showing GP2 and GP3 live on Sky Sports F1 HD. There are six former GP2 champions in Formula 1 this season, including Lewis Hamilton and last year's winner Romain Grosjean. The series promises nail-biting and fascinating racing and we'll track gifted drivers through the ranks as they aim for Formula 1."

This year sees Jolyon Palmer embark on his second full campaign of GP2 driving for leading British team iSport after a promising rookie season with Arden in 2011. Jolyon is next in action from 28 February to 1 March for official pre-season testing in Jerez, Spain with full coverage on www.jolyonpalmer.com.
